 * Hi,
    if you book an appointment and go to the last step, but instead of finalize
   or refreshed and return to the first step, previously unavailable days are displayed
   as available and this leads to double bookings. I recognize the same problem 
   on the demo page on your homepage.
 * I make a booking choose an extra amount go to the last step and instead of finalize
   open the demo window again and go step by step and all dates are available at
   once.
    It doesn’t happen all the time, but occasionally. Maybe you already know
   that, otherwise I hope that it will be fixed soon.

 * I tested something and maybe it will help you further.
 * During all the testing, I noticed that it only occurs when you are logged in (
   error only after logging in).
    I have set up a session timeout for customers 
   and as soon as the customer is logged out again (session timeout 1 min) everything
   works as it should. Is there perhaps a way to set the plugin so that all data
   is undone when the page is refreshed (logout and selected services)?
 * Since I also have this problem if the customer wants to book another appointment
   and as long as he is logged in, the error persists.
